@chessceo/mcp
Model Context Protocol server for chess.ceo — 11.7M+ games, ~1.5M FIDE player profiles, opening preparation, live broadcasts. Lets Claude, Cursor, and any other MCP host answer chess questions directly against real data instead of hallucinating.
No API key. No auth. No state. Free to use.
What it can do
The server exposes 8 tools that mirror the public GET API surface at chess.ceo:
| Tool | What it answers |
|---|---|
search_player |
"Find FIDE ID for Magnus Carlsen" |
get_player_profile |
"How strong is X, what do they play, who have they beaten" |
get_player_preparation |
"What does X play against 1.e4? What's their win rate with the Najdorf?" |
get_position_stats |
"From this position, which move scores best in the 11.7M-game database?" |
get_head_to_head |
"What's the record between X and Y?" |
list_live_tournaments |
"What's being broadcast live right now?" |
list_tournament_players |
"Who's playing in tournament T?" |
list_player_live_tournaments |
"Is X playing anywhere right now?" |
Install (Claude Desktop)
Add to your claude_desktop_config.json (~/Library/Application Support/Claude/claude_desktop_config.json on macOS, %APPDATA%\Claude\claude_desktop_config.json on Windows):
{
"mcpServers": {
"chessceo": {
"command": "npx",
"args": ["-y", "@chessceo/mcp"]
}
}
}
Restart Claude Desktop. You should see the chess.ceo tools appear in the tool list at the bottom of the chat.
Install (Cursor)
Similar ~/.cursor/mcp.json:
{
"mcpServers": {
"chessceo": {
"command": "npx",
"args": ["-y", "@chessceo/mcp"]
}
}
}
Install (Claude Code)
This repo is also a Claude Code plugin marketplace, so you can add it directly:
/plugin marketplace add chessceo/chessceo-mcp
/plugin install chessceo@chessceo
Claude Code will pull the plugin from GitHub and wire the MCP server automatically. Enable "Sync automatically" in the marketplace UI if you want future updates fetched on push.

Prep workflow (built-in prompts)
For MCP hosts that show prompts in a slash-menu (Claude Desktop, Cursor, Claude Code), three pre-baked prompts are included so users get a proper preparation workflow without prompt-engineering their own:
| Prompt | Purpose |
|---|---|
prepare_for_game(me, opponent, my_color?, time_control?) |
Full pre-match workflow: resolves both players, weights games by recency + format (classical OTB > rapid/blitz > online), walks the opponent's repertoire looking for lines where they score under 40%, checks head-to-head, and delivers a concrete plan with the moves to steer toward the opponent's weak points. |
scout_player(player) |
Deep scouting report on one player — style, top openings, recent form, biggest wins and losses, recurring weaknesses. |
head_to_head_briefing(player_a, player_b) |
One-paragraph read on the history between two players — who has the edge, dominant openings, style clash, current form. |
Pick one from the host's slash-menu, fill in the arguments, and the model does the rest.

Self-host the HTTP transport
The same package can run as a persistent HTTP server, not just a stdio subprocess:
chessceo-mcp --transport=http --http-port=8080 --http-host=127.0.0.1
Flags (or the corresponding env vars):
| Flag | Env var | Default | Purpose |
|---|---|---|---|
--transport |
MCP_TRANSPORT |
stdio |
stdio or http |
--http-port |
MCP_HTTP_PORT |
8080 |
Port to bind |
--http-host |
MCP_HTTP_HOST |
127.0.0.1 |
Bind address |
--http-path |
MCP_HTTP_PATH |
/mcp |
Streamable-HTTP endpoint |
GET /healthz returns 200 ok\n — wire it into your uptime monitor.

What's under the hood
The chess.ceo public API is a GET-only surface documented at chess.ceo/llms.txt. This MCP server is a thin wrapper — one tool per endpoint, with input schemas so LLMs can call them safely. When you ask the model a chess question, it picks the right tool, calls it, and reasons over the JSON. Nothing is invented; the data is straight from the database.
